IMSDLBKO=



determines the value of the BKO parameter when the SAS System invokes an IMS/ESA DLI or DBB region.

V5 Alias: DLIBKO=
Syntax: IMSDLBKO=* | Y | N or DLIBKO=* | Y | N
Default: IMSDLBKO=* specifies that the BKO parameter is null in the IMS-DL/I region parameter list, so the default IMS-DL/I action is taken.
Valid as part of: SAS invocation or in the OPTIONS statement.
Interface(s): Engine, DATA step
Restrictable: N
Details: The BKO parameter setting determines whether or not updates in a disk log are backed out automatically if the program abends. When IMSDLBKO=Y and the SAS session abends, all database updates since the last CHKP call are backed out automatically unless the system crashed. (If IMSDLBKO=Y, a DASD log data set must be used.)
